Sørina's friend Michael Hitchcock, co-director of a radical nonprofit, shares his hatred of euphemistic language and explains how enforcing civil discourse can be unfair and oppressive. The two of them talk about propaganda and narrative-shaping in the hands of the powerful, and he defines important terms such as "intersectionality" and "genocide."
